angularjs 九
发布时间:2020-12-17 09:58:10 所属栏目:安全 来源:网络整理
导读:import {Component} from 'angular2/core';import {ExponentialStrengthPipe} from './exponential-strength';@Component({ selector: 'appTest',template: ` h2Power Booster/h2 p Super power boost: {{10 | exponentialStrength : 10}} /p `,pipes: [Expo
import {Component} from 'angular2/core'; import {ExponentialStrengthPipe} from './exponential-strength'; @Component({ selector: 'appTest',template: ` <h2>Power Booster</h2> <p> Super power boost: {{10 | exponentialStrength : 10}} </p> `,pipes: [ExponentialStrengthPipe] }) export class App { }
/** * Created by dell on 2016/9/8. */ import {Pipe,PipeTransform} from 'angular2/core'; /* * Raise the value exponentially * Takes an exponent argument that defaults to 1. * Usage: * value | exponentialStrength:exponent * Example: * {{ 2 | exponentialStrength:10}} * formats to: 1024 */ @Pipe({name: 'exponentialStrength'}) export class ExponentialStrengthPipe implements PipeTransform { transform(value:number,args:string[]) : any { return value + parseInt(args[0]); } } (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|